Re: Day 3 BPA's by position
All three would be excellent additions.
I can't speak for everyone, but what I like about Swope is his balance. He has really outstanding balance, which helps when he goes up for a pass and is getting hit at the same time. Even though he isn't the biggest receiver, he's not easy to take down.
Plus, you have to love his speed and route running. Definitely nice things to have.
Finally, and this is something I look for as well from college receivers, I noticed that when he is catching sideline passes he makes an effort to drag both feet rather than just one. That is a small thing, but it is something that collegiate receivers have to get used to in the NFL. He already does it.
